How to prepare for a job interview at Affinity Workforce
✨Know Your Curriculum
Make sure you’re familiar with the KS3 and KS4 curriculum. Brush up on the subjects you’ll be teaching and think about how you can engage students with different learning styles. This will show your passion for education and your readiness to adapt.
✨Showcase Your Experience
If you have experience working with children with additional needs, be ready to share specific examples. Discuss strategies you've used to support these students and how you’ve adapted your teaching methods to meet their needs. This will highlight your flexibility and positive approach.
✨Prepare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the school’s culture, support for teachers, and professional development opportunities. This shows that you’re genuinely interested in the role and want to ensure it’s a good fit for you too.
✨Practice Your Teaching Demo
If you're asked to deliver a teaching demo, practice it thoroughly. Choose a topic you’re comfortable with and think about how to make it interactive. Remember, this is your chance to showcase your teaching style and connect with the students, even if they’re just pretend!
